A medical assembly for delivering an implant comprising a tubular resilient implant defining an inner lumen, the implant comprising a plurality of engaging members extending proximally an end thereof, the implant having a delivery configuration, and a released configuration, and a delivery assembly for delivering the implant, the delivery assembly comprising an outer tubular member extending through the inner lumen of the implant, the outer tubular member having a plurality of slots receiving therethrough the engaging members, with the implant being disposed in its delivery configuration on an outer surface of the outer tubular member, an inner tubular member coaxially disposed within the outer tubular member and movable relative to the outer tubular member, the inner tubular member having a first axial position that restrains the engaging members, and a second axial position to thereby release the implant from the delivery assembly.